Carbonic acid is a chemical compound with the chemical formulaH 2 CO 3 (equivalently OC(OH) 2).It is also a name sometimes given to solutions of carbon dioxide in water (carbonated water), because such solutions contain small amounts of H 2 CO 3.In physiology, carbonic acid is described as volatile acid or respiratory acid, because it is the only acid excreted as a gas by the lungs. In the absence of water, the dissociation of gaseous carbonic acid is predicted to be very slow, with a half-life in the gas-phase of 180,000 years at 300 K.[15] This only applies if the molecules are few and far apart, because it has also been predicted that gas-phase carbonic acid will catalyze its own decomposition by forming dimers, which then break apart into two molecules each of water and carbon dioxide.
